Nestled in the serene mountains of eastern Kentucky, Pinsonfork offers an array of camping options for outdoor enthusiasts seeking adventure amid stunning natural beauty. RV campers can find welcoming sites at nearby campgrounds, such as the Breaks Interstate Park, which provides full-service amenities and breathtaking views of the Breaks of Sandy Creek gorge. For those who prefer tent camping, Turkey Foot Campground offers well-maintained sites that allow visitors to immerse themselves in the lush woodlands, ideal for hiking, fishing, and birdwatching along its peaceful streams. Dispersed camping in the adjacent Daniel Boone National Forest provides a more rugged experience for seasoned campers, allowing for solitude amidst the towering trees and winding trails. The diverse terrain of the region, characterized by rolling hills and vibrant foliage, sets the perfect backdrop for all types of camping adventures. Whether youβre traveling in an RV, pitching a tent, or seeking a secluded spot in the woods, Pinsonfork is a hidden gem that promises an unforgettable outdoor experience.
